Manchester United fans loved what Aaron Wan-Bissaka did vs Perth Glory

Aaron Wan-Bissaka made his Manchester United debut as a second half substitute against Perth Glory, and fans were instantly impressed by what they saw.

The former Crystal Palace right-back, who signed for an initial £45m, came on at the start of the second half in Perth in United's first pre-season friendly of the summer.

While United were dominant for most of the game, a stubborn Perth defence restricted goalscoring opportunities until Marcus Rashford gave them the lead on the hour mark.

But Wan-Bissaka was alert to prevent two possible counter-attacks before Rashford's strike, sticking out a leg on both occasions to cleanly take the ball back for United when his opponent seemed to have shaken him off.

Fellow new signing Daniel James had impressed in the first half, and United fans were similarly impressed with Wan-Bissaka's debut performance for the club.
